    Quote Originally Posted by tio fa li
    I open a document from Dropbox, read it, edit with Pages... Up to now everything wonderful.

    My problem is that I just can't find the way to save my document into Dropbox again.

    Do you know how to do it?
    To integrate Dropbox into Pages/Numbers/Keyboards, you will need to use a service, such as Dropdav http://www.dropdav.com/.

    All you need to do is set up an account with them (if your Dropbox account is free, then Dropdav is also free, otherwise it costs 30% of the Dropbox subscription). After you create an account there, just go to Pages, select Copy to WebDav and set the server to https://dav.dropdav.com, and for the user name and password, use the dropbox account credentials.

    Easy setup and works a treat.
